Distribution of students according to correct practice and correct knowledge of personal hygiene (n = 104).
| Indicators of personal hygiene | Correct practice | Correct knowledge | Z |
|---|---|---|---|
| Combing hair | 50 (48.08) | 77 (74.04) | -4.21 |
| Studying under adequate light | 9 (8.65) | 42 (40.38) | -5.22 |
| Brushing teeth | 52 (50.00) | 68 (65.38) | -2.2 |
| Washing mouth after eating | 64 (61.54) | 75 (72.12) | -1.59 |
| Washing hands before eating | 88 (84.62) | 100 (96.15) | -2.76 |
| Washing hands after visiting toilet | 98 (94.23) | 103 (99.04) | -1.87 |
| Trimming nails | 80 (76.92) | 102 (98.08) | -4.52 |
| Taking bath daily | 44 (42.31) | 47 (45.19) | -0.41 |
| Wearing shoes | 58 (55.77) | 26 (25.00) | 4.43 |
| Wearing clean clothes | 13 (12.50) | 15 (14.42) | -0.4 |
Figures in the parentheses indicate percentages;
Multiple responses.

Distribution of students according to practice of personal hygiene and literacy status of mother (n = 104).
| Practice of personal hygiene (score) | Literacy status of mother | Total |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Illiterate | Primary | Middle | ||
| Poor (< 8) | 18 (25.35) | 1 (5.55) | - | 19 (18.27) |
| Good (8-12) | 42 (59.15) | 5 (27.78) | 2 (13.33) | 49 (47.12) |
| Very good (13-15) | 11 (15.50) | 12 (66.67) | 4 (26.67) | 27 (25.96) |
| Excellent (16-20) | - | - | 9 (60.00) | 9 (8.65) |
| Total | 71 (100.00) | 18 (100.00) | 15 (100.00) | 104 (100.00) |
Figures in the parentheses indicate percentages;
Illiterate: Those who cannot read or write;
Primary: Grade I to IV.
Middle: Grade V to VIII;
χ2 = 36.7, d.f. = 2, p < 0.001. Chi-square test was applied after classifying literacy status of mother as illiterate and literate (with education primary and above), and practice of personal hygiene as poor, good and very good / excellent.
